As any outdoor enthusiast knows, starting a campfire isn’t always as simple as you think it will be. You can eliminate the scavenging for dry twigs and painstaking assembly with the Radiate Portable Campfire, a 4 lbs tin that ignites to offer up to 5 hours of burn time. Simply pop the lid, light it up, and cook your marshmallows and hot dogs. Each is made in the USA from 100% recycled soy wax and paper briquettes, and is waterproof so that the elements aren’t an issue. You can also use it as an impromptu fire pit in the backyard should you not want to shell out the money on a full-size one. Best of all, it’s reusable, so you can put out the fire and use it again. We will admit the price is a bit of a deterrent, but it does bring a level of convenience to any camping trip.
